Ashley Smith for Free People's July 2011 Catalogue

Free People offers a sneak peak at its July catalogue starring Ashley Smith alongside Anastasia Khodkina and Jessica Mau. Photographed in Austin, Texas by Alexandra Valenti; the July look book is inspired by rock and roll greats such as Stevie Nicks and Janis Joplin with feminine lace, fringe and denim.
